Inspector Notes
An unannounced monitoring inspection was conducted today from 10:00am-12:20pm. There were 61 children (infants-5yrs.) directly supervised by 13 staff. The physical plant, staff records, children?s records, medications, evacuation drills, injury reports, emergency supplies, and policies were inspected. Children were observed participating in group play, reading books, playing outside, water play and infant feeding routines. Diapering and hand-washing procedures were also observed. There was an ample supply of materials for the children. Areas of non-compliance are identified in the Violation Notice.
